ISO 17100 is the internationally recognized standard for translation services. It defines a comprehensive process for delivering high-quality linguistic products. Rather than just looking at the final document, this standard scrutinizes the entire ecosystem of a translation project, from the initial quote to the archiving of the project files.
Risk Mitigation: What is ISO 17100’s Role in Business Safety?
When businesses ask, “what is ISO 17100?”, they are often looking for a way to ensure consistency. The standard provides a framework that minimizes human error through structured project management. Key elements include:
- Standardized Workflows: By following a mandatory sequence of translation, revision, and verification, the likelihood of an error reaching the final consumer is significantly reduced.
- Technological Integration: The standard encourages the proper use of translation tools and technology to maintain terminology consistency, which is vital for technical manuals and legal contracts.
- Feedback Loops: It requires a systematic process for handling client feedback, ensuring that any preferences or corrections are integrated into future projects.
Project Management Excellence: What is ISO 17100 for TSPs?
For a Translation Service Provider (TSP), being certified means more than just having good translators. It involves having a professional infrastructure. The standard requires that project managers possess the specific competencies needed to handle the linguistic, technical, and administrative challenges of complex, multi-language projects.
This includes everything from managing secure file transfers to ensuring that the style and tone of the translation align with the client’s specific brand requirements. Under the ISO 17100 framework, every step is documented, creating a clear audit trail that ensures accountability.
